The first thing a visitor will notice is the pentagon-shaped fortified wall that encircles the city. The Taroudant historical wall is the oldest wall in Morocco and the third most robust in the world, according to historian A. Hermas, after the Great Wall of China.

Day 5: Ouarzazate - Taroudant

We will drive for about 35km from Ouarzazate to “Ait Ben Haddou” Kasbah, which was built in the 11th century, and which was once a prior caravan route across the Sahara desert and Marrakesh. It is located on a hill along with the Ounila river, in a time where many part of it are completely damaged as a consequence of rainstorms and windstorms, it still the famous one in Morocco. Just a few people, around five families are still living around the Kasbah, whereas the other inhabitants are currently moved to a more modern village. Then, we will continue to check in a hotel at Taroudant.
